Alright, so let’s switch gears a bit and talk business. What should we know?
Dirty Sports Books is a playful publishing company that celebrates the slang, humor, and double entendres found in every sport. I wanted to create something fresh and unexpected—coffee-table books that are smart, cheeky, and truly original.
Each title—from Dirty Baseball. to Dirty Pickleball. and Dirty Tennis.—transforms everyday sports lingo into a wink-worthy celebration of culture, competition, and camaraderie.
What sets Dirty Sports Books apart is that the humor comes from inside the game. Athletes love it just as much as fans do. The books are clean enough for your living room, but sassy enough to make you grin. I’m most proud of how these books bring people together through laughter—bridging the gap between players, fans, and anyone who appreciates a clever double meaning.
At its core, the brand is about fun, wit, and connection. It’s not just about sports—it’s about the way we play, talk, and tease. Truly clean books for the dirty mind.
